What’s Your Ideal Summer Vacation?
What do you want out of your summer vacation? The key to making the most out of your summer is to decide what you want to do. After taking a week or two to relax after the school year is over, start thinking about what memories you want to have of your summer.
Everyone has his or her own idea of what summer vacation should be. Your parents may think it’s a time for you to earn money, or a time to get ahead in school by taking summer classes. Even if some of your summer is already planned out around a job or summer school, make sure you fit in what’s important to you. Whether it’s learning how to swim or volunteering at a local day camp, you can find plenty of opportunities in your community!
Quick Facts
  • Most teens work in restaurants or in retail sales (about 26% in each).

  • 35% of teens are working to have extra spending money, 29% to save for college, and 22% to pay for a car
